POLICE are warning elderly residents not to let strangers into their homes after a spate of distraction burglaries in Stroud.
Inspector Nick Browne, of Stroud Inspector Neighbourhood Area, asked residents to confirm callers' details with the authority they claim to represent before letting anyone in.
He said anyone in doubt should call the police on 0845 090 1234.
